Capture Crystal-Clear Audio with Professional Quality
Introducing the Neewer USB200 Microphone Kit. Designed with a professional sound chipset, this USB microphone delivers high-resolution audio capture, ideal for streaming, video recording, and conference calls. The complete kit ensures you have everything needed for a professional setup.
Specifications:- Microphone Type: USB Condenser Mic
- Sampling Rate: 192kHz/24Bit
- Frequency Response: 30Hz-16kHz
- Polar Pattern: Cardioid
- Connectivity: USB B to USB A (78.7in/2m Cable)
- Compatibility: Laptops, Desktop PCs (Windows and Mac), Smartphones with OTG adapter (not included)
- Includes: Suspension Scissor Arm Stand, Table Mounting Clamp, Anti Shock Mount, Pop Filter Windscreen, USB Cable, Foam Cap, Nut, User Manual
